About the event

Clay-Glo Forest is a sensory workshop that encourages children to experiment with natural forms and materials in clay. Participants then dust their creations with glo-pigments to make them come alive in the dark!

 This fun festive activity aims to celebrate urban natural diversity and highlight the role trees play in supporting the ecosystems in our city.

Come join us for a foraging walk and then at the Clay-Glo Grotto!
